Sheen and Richards' Summer Resolution
Who needs animosity in August?
Charlie Sheen and Denise Richards apparently don't. According to the estranged couple's attorneys, the pair have "amicably resolved" the various issues that have been gnawing at them since Richards opened full-fledged divorce proceedings against her hubby in January.
Those "issues" included a restraining order obtained by Richards in April that had been keeping Sheen at least 300 yards away from her and their two daughters; her claims that her supposedly drug-and-gambling-addict husband had threatened to kill her; Sheen's alleged porn and prostitute habits; and Richards' overall fear for her safety. Not to mention Sheen's denial that any of Richards' allegations were true.
Neither Richards' attorney, Neal Hersh, nor Sheen's lawyer, Lance Spiegel, would comment on the details of the resolution reached Monday during a private hearing in Los Angeles Superior Court, but they said that the restraining order--which was temporarily extended last month--has been dropped.
They also said that no official judgment was rendered pertaining to the divorce and no upcoming court dates have been scheduled.
A Sept. 12 custody hearing has been X-ed off the docket, as well. Sheen has been having supervised visits with two-year-old Sam and one-year-old Lola once a week since May. The Emmy-nominated actor is seeking joint custody of the girls.
The Two and a Half Men star also happens to be seeking a million-dollar-per-episode paycheck for his role on the CBS sitcom next year. But a different set of judges will decide that one.
Richards, 35, who is now romantically attached to Bon Jovi guitarist Richie Sambora--and no longer friends with Sambora ex Heather Locklear--originally filed for divorce from Sheen, 40, in March 2005 when she was six months pregnant with their second child.
The two attempted a reconciliation in the fall, full of public diamond ring-wearing and declarations of happiness on late night talk shows, but Richards was back in court Jan. 4 to carry on with the divorce.
